First Generation (2009–2013)
Pros and Cons
Pros:
- Spacious interior and large cargo capacity
- Affordable in the used car market
- Simple and straightforward design
Cons:
- Outdated technology and infotainment system
- Limited engine options
- Some owners report CVT issues
Key Features and Updates Introduced
- Basic infotainment system
- Comfortable seating for long drives
- Adequate safety features for the time
Engine Options and Fuel Efficiency
- 1.6L Engine: ~14 km/l
- 2.0L Engine: ~15 km/l
Known Problems and Common Issues
- CVT transmission reliability issues
- Air conditioning problems in hotter climates (important for KSA buyers)
- Manufacturer recalls for specific electrical faults

Overview
The first-generation Renault Fluence offers practicality and affordability but lacks modern features and reliability in certain areas. While the spacious interior makes it ideal for families, buyers in KSA should be cautious about potential transmission issues and consider models from later years for better reliability.

Tips Before Purchasing
- Inspect the Transmission: Pay special attention to CVT models, as earlier generations are prone to issues.
- Check for Recalls: Ensure all manufacturer recalls have been addressed.
- Service History: Look for a well-maintained model with documented service records.
- Test the AC System: Given KSA’s hot climate, ensure the air conditioning works efficiently.
- Negotiate Price: Renault Fluence models often have lower resale value, so negotiate for the best deal.
